Hillary Clinton tests COVID-19 positive

| @indiablooms | Mar 23, 2022, at 02:33 pm

Washington: Former US Secretary of State Hillary Clinton on Tuesday announced she has tested COVID-19 positive.

The former first lady of the nation, however, said she is experiencing mild symptoms.

"Well, I've tested positive for COVID. I've got some mild cold symptoms but am feeling fine. I'm more grateful than ever for the protection vaccines can provide against serious illness," she tweeted.

"Please get vaccinated and boosted if you haven't already!" she advised people.

Meanwhile, Hillary CLintonn informed that her husband and former US President Bill Clinton tested negative.

"Bill tested negative and is feeling fine. He's quarantining until our household is fully in the clear. Movie recommendations appreciated!" she said.
